(10/033) Civilian Dead in Van, Erciş…

A witness spoke on the incident in Van’s Erciş district where taxi driver Zafer Ceyhan and Önder Polat were killed after their car was shot at by police officers on September 28, 2017. The statement of the witness to press is as follows: ‘‘Taxi entered the school’s street. I saw military vehicles coming after the taxi. 200-300 meters later the car stopped and people in it fled. Owner of the car approached to police officers. Officers stopped the car. Many police officers and special forces took the man out of the taxi and made him lay on the ground. I heard a couple of gunshots. Than they asked the driver his father’s, mother’s name. The man did not respond. I heard a couple of more shots. 2 minutes passed then I heard the man on the ground yelling. I didn’t see how many people fled the car. But one was running away. They held the man that got away from the car 200 meters. They killed him there.’’

 (10/034) Torture Allegation in İstanbul Police Headquarters…

A joint press briefing was made by TIHV and IHD for Mustafa Koçak who has been kept in İstanbul Police Headquarters Counterterrorism branch for 10 days. Koçak has been tortured allegedly. IHD Istanbul Chair, co-Chair Gülseren Yoleri, TIHV Chair Prof. Dr. Şebnem Korur and TIHV Istanbul Officer Ümit Efe attended the meeting.

During the meeting, it was stated that Koçak faced physical and psychological torture. Police officers reportedly put a tin can around Koçak’s head and continuously hit the can for hours.

Koçak was also forced to become a spy, was threatened with his life and rape of his mother and sister. It is also declared that a restriction order was issued for 109 attorneys that had publicized the torture claims.

 (10/037) Police Operations in Silvan …

It is reported that after Sergeant Mehmet Kızıl was shot during an armed assault in Diyarbakır’s Silvan district on October 3, 2017, operations began in the area. Reportedly, every vehicle passing through Diyarbakır Street is stopped for ID controls. It is also learned that many houses were raided resulting with detentions. No information is provided on the number of detentions, names of the detainees and where they were taken.

 (10/038) Torture and Ill-Treatment in Prison…

It is learned that 13 prisoners in Muş Type E prison were transferred to several other locations in Karadeniz. Allegedly a tunnel was found within the ward of PKK defendants and it is reported that the tunnel is the reason of the transfer. Names of defendants learned: Mesut Şancı, Cihan Yıldırak, Sabahattin Nergis.

It is learned from news coverage of October 3, 2017 that routine morning and evening counts are executed by military personnel in Ağrı prison. It is reported that social and sportive rights of prisoners were limited and prisoners were forced to carry prisoner identities whenever they leave their cells to meet with attorneys, make a phone call or go to the infirmary.

It is learned from news coverage of October 4, 2017, that routine morning and evening counts are executed by military personnel in Afyonkarahisar prison.  Prisoners are reportedly forced to stand in military fashion, books and magazines belonging to prisoners are taken by the administration, letters written in Kurdish by the prisoners or sent by the prisoners were prohibited and investigated. It is reported that prisoners decided to boycott closed and open visitations and phone calls to protest right violations.

 (10/040) Number of Children Between Ages of 0-6 in Prison…

Minister of Justice Abdülhamit Gül answered HDP İzmir MP Müslüm Doğan’s parliamentary question regarding the number of children in prison. Gül declared that as of April 7, 2017, the number of children between ages of 0-6 staying in prison with their mothers is 594.

 (10/041) Rejection of Meeting Request with Abdullah Öcalan…

It is learned that on October 3, 2017 PKK Leader Abdullah Öcalan’s attorneys İbrahim Bilmez, Ebru Günay and Faik Özgür Erol requested from Bursa Public Prosecutor’s Office to meet with him. The request was denied on the same day based on limitations regarding the convicted prisoners due to Law on the Execution of Criminal and Security Measures Number 5275. With this latest decline meeting requests with Öcalan have been denied for the 691st time.

(10/042) Police Intervention Towards ‘‘I Want My Job Back’’ demonstrations in Ankara…

Civil servants discharged from their jobs with KHK legislations planned for a press meeting in front of the Human Rights Monument in Ankara Yüksel Street on October 3, 2017. The resistance of the group has been going on for a certain period. Two meetings planned at 13.00 and 18.00 respectively were both prevented by the police forces who clocked entrance to the street by barriers.

During the police intervention at 13.30 police teared a banner one woman was carrying and detained her. It is learned that 3 other people were physically abused and detained later at the 18.00 meeting.

 (10/050) Trial of Police Officers Killed in Ceylanpınar…

The trial for the killings of 2 police officers at their houses in Ceylanpınar continued on October 3, 2017. 4 of 9 defendants of the case were already arrested. Prosecution requested extra time for the preparation of the final opinion as to the accusations for the 4th time. The court ruled for the continuity of arrests and adjourned the trial to November 22, 2017. Defendants testimonies in Kurdish were recorded as ‘an unknown language to the court’.

 (10/051) Trial of Medeni Yıldırım…

It is learned from news coverage of October 4, 2017 that defendant soldier Adem Çiftçi’s acquittance in Medeni Yıldırım case was overruled by Gaziantep District Court. Medeni Yıldırım was shot dead on June 28, 2013 while protesting the construction of a new patrol in Diyarbakır’s Lice district. Yıldırım was shot at from the patrol.

 (10/052) Trials in Connection with the Coup d’État Attempt…

The final hearing for the trial of 7 former police officers took place on October 3, 2017. The case was opened by Ankara Heavy Penal Court No 17. 7 officers were accused of locking the gun cabinet and preventing distributions of rifles and steel vests during July 15 Coup attempt. Following the defenses the court sentenced Eyüp Sami Duran and Serdal Bilgin to life sentences. Other defendants were sentenced to 9 to 12 years.

The final hearing for the trial of Attorney Nazmi Değirmenci took place in Adana 11th Heavy Penal Court. Following the defenses the court sentenced Değirmenci to 6 years 3 months due to ‘membership of an illegal organization’.

 (010/054) Dismissal of MP Status for HDP MP…

HDP Siirt MP Besime Konca’s MP status has been dismissed after her definitive prison sentence was declared at the General Assembly. Konca was sentenced by Batman Heavy Penal Court to 2 years 6 months, due to ‘making propaganda of an illegal organization’. The penalty was definitive as of July 13, 2017. With Konca’s dismissal the number of seats HDP has in TBMM deacreased to 54. Previously MP statuses of following MP’s were dismissed: Figen Yüksekdağ, Nursel Aydoğan, Tuğba Hezer Öztürk and Faysal Sarıyıldız.
